Transaction 602cc317d136340e85333703c120dc95f30c9bb613f02c1a9abfb7589d80fc97
1 Input
1 Output
-
602cc317d136340e85333703c120dc95f30c9bb613f02c1a9abfb7589d80fc97:0
- value
- 1293290
- script pubkey
- OP_0 OP_PUSHBYTES_32 f1bc67af79741f04fce56590635a37fc7ed0ae24bd180c4dd0927cc454974618
- address
- bc1q7x7x0tmews0sfl89vkgxxk3hl3ldpt3yh5vqcnwsjf7vg4yhgcvqw63cel